Timeline

2023-12
AITO M9 officially launched in China, marking the brand's entry into the luxury SUV segment.
2024-02
AITO M9 deliveries commence, quickly becoming a top-selling luxury SUV in the Chinese market.
2024-09
Huawei announces the 'Qiankun' brand for its intelligent automotive solutions, signaling a shift in branding for its vehicle tech.
2025-05
AITO M9 reaches cumulative sales milestone of 100,000 units.
